Summary of differences between kefir and egg whites

  • Kefir has more phosphorus, calcium, vitamin A, vitamin B12, and vitamin D; however, egg whites are higher in selenium and vitamin B2.
  • Egg whites cover your daily need for selenium, 30% more than kefir.
  • Kefir has less sodium.
  • The glycemic index of kefir is higher.

These are the specific foods used in this comparison Kefir, lowfat, plain, LIFEWAY and Egg, white, raw, fresh.
